General-duty citation text
Section 5(a)(1) of the Occupational Safety and Health Act of 1970: The employer did not furnish employment and a place of employment which were free from recognized hazards that were causing or likely to cause death or serious physical harm to employees in that employees were exposed to: On or about July 15, 2009, employees were utilizing a Yale powered industrial truck and had not recieved sufficient training in that the operators were not familiar with the requirements as specified in paragraph (l).
